About the Tropius Pokémon Card

Tropius is a Colorless-type Pokémon card with 110 HP from the Journey Together set, part of the Scarlet & Violet series. It carries the collector number 123/159 and is classified as Common. The Journey Together set was released on March 28, 2025.

The card includes the flavor text: “Delicious fruits grew out from around its neck because it always ate the same kind of fruit.”.

Grading the Tropius Pokémon Card

Whether Tropius is worth grading comes down to condition. Before submitting a card, collectors usually check front and back centring, corner sharpness, edge wear, surface defects, and any print lines or factory imperfections.

Across the hobby, top grades such as PSA 10, BGS/Beckett 9.5–10, and CGC Pristine 10 generally command a premium over raw or lower-graded copies.

PSA has graded 4 copies of this card, of which 1 earned a PSA 10 — a gem rate of about 25.0%. These population figures were last refreshed on June 15, 2026.
